Cataract is one of the common eye diseases that endanger human health and is the primary cause of blindness in the elderly. Cataract surgery has developed rapidly in the past half century, and has gone through three stages: intracapsular cataract extraction, extracapsular cataract extraction and ultrasound emulsion extraction, and the surgical incision has also changed from 11mm in the capsule, to 7mm in the extracapsular, to 3mm in ultrasound emulsion, with the trend of smaller and smaller incisions. At present, most of the cataract ultrasonic emulsification surgeries performed in China have an incision of 3.0-3.2 mm. The size of the surgical incision is related to postoperative astigmatism, inflammation, and the speed of postoperative recovery. Alcon USA’s ultrasound emulsification system is the most advanced cataract ultrasound emulsification device in the world. Its unique twisting mode provides microincision-coaxial cataract surgery technology. Its newly developed surgical system can further reduce the cataract surgical incision from 3.2mm to 2.2mm, which reduces surgical trauma and complications, and greatly improves the safety of surgery. Cataract patients can quickly recover their vision after surgery, and the astigmatism caused by the surgical incision has been significantly reduced. Clinical research data reported that a 3.0mm surgery can produce 0.33D astigmatism, while a 2.2mm surgery only produces 0.11D astigmatism, and such a small amount of astigmatism has negligible effect on postoperative vision. Therefore, the microincision-coaxial cataract ultrasound emulsification technique not only shortens the recovery time of patients, but also significantly improves the postoperative vision of cataract patients.
